Jannik Sinner will remain the world No. 1 player after Wimbledon 2024.
The young Italian recently climbed to the top spot in ATP rankings and has already spent three weeks there. He’ll continue adding more weeks to his reign at the top.
His closest rivals had a slim chance to dethrone him at Wimbledon, where he needs to defend 720 points from last year’s semi-finals . But thanks to his Halle Open win, Sinner has secured enough points that no one can catch him during the tournament.
Wimbledon Points Drama:
Carlos Alcaraz, a former world No. 1, can’t gain any points at Wimbledon since he won last year and must defend those 2,000 points. This could drop his total to 6,130 points, putting him at risk of losing his No. 3 spot to Alexander Zverev unless he performs well in London.
